I’m Kathleen Browne — a social worker, author, and parent of an adult son with unique needs. My journey started not in an office, but in hospital corridors, therapy waiting rooms, and countless meetings where I had to fight to have my child’s voice heard. Parenting a child with a disability has shaped not just my life, but my passion for helping other families navigate the challenges, confusion, and emotional weight that come with this extraordinary journey.

Today, I run my own private practice as a Registered Social Worker, offering support coordination, parent coaching, advocacy, and transition planning. Through my practice, I’ve guided families through the NDIS maze, supported parents in crisis, and helped individuals build calmer, more confident paths forward. My work is grounded in both lived experience and professional expertise, so when I say “I understand,” I truly mean it.

I’m also the author of The Unique Parent Club: Navigating the Extraordinary Journey of Special Needs Parenting, a book that combines my personal story with practical tools to help parents feel seen, supported, and capable.
